The Crohn's & Colitis Foundation is the leading non-profit organization focused on both research and patient support for in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). The Foundation’s mission is to cure Crohn's disease and ulcerative colitis, and to improve the quality of life for the millions of Americans living with IBD. Our work is dramatically accelerating the research process through our database and investment initiatives; we also provide extensive educational resources for patients and their families, medical professionals, and the public.

Stress can significantly worsen IBD symptoms, triggering flares and increasing gut inflammation due to the brain-gut connection. While you can't eliminate stress entirely, managing it effectively can make a big difference in your IBD journey and potentially reduce flare frequency.
